High-Protein Mini Cinnamon Rolls: Quick, Soft, and Delicious

  • Total Time: 37 min

Ingredients

Dough

1¼ cups all-purpose flour

1 cup blended cottage cheese (2% or higher)

2 tablespoons maple syrup

1½ teaspoons baking powder

Filling

¼ cup light brown sugar

1 tablespoon protein powder (vanilla or unflavored)

1 tablespoon ground cinnamon

Frosting

2 tablespoons cream cheese, softened

¼ cup blended cottage cheese

1 tablespoon maple syrup

Optional

1 tablespoon melted butter


Instructions

  1. Preheat oven: 350°F (175°C) and line a small ba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Make dough: Mix flour, blended cottage cheese, maple syrup, and baking powder. Knead until smooth. Roll into a 4×8-inch rectangle.
  3. Prepare filling: Mix brown sugar, protein powder, and cinnamon. Spread evenly over dough.
  4. Roll and cut: Roll dough lengthwise into a log. Cut into 4 equal rolls. Seal edges with a little water.
  5. Bake: Place rolls on the baking sheet and bake for 20–22 minutes until golden.
  6. Make frosting: Blend cream cheese, cottage cheese, and maple syrup until smooth. Brush rolls with melted butter (optional), then frost before serving.

Notes

  • Frost just before serving for best results.
  • Use higher-fat cottage cheese for better texture.
  • Rolls freeze well; thaw completely before baking.
  • Optional flavor variations: nuts, chocolate chips, fruit, or pistachio butter.
  • Prep Time: 15 min
  • Cook Time: 22 min
